Club Delphi  
    Paypal   F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Bases de datos > Firebird e Interbase
Registrarse FAQ Miembros Calendario Guía de estilo Buscar Temas de Hoy Marcar Foros Como Leídos

Respuesta
 
Herramientas Buscar en Tema Desplegado
  #1  
Antiguo 16-05-2011
coej coej is offline
Miembro
NULL
 
Registrado: abr 2011
Ubicación: MANCHEGO-ESPAÑOL
Posts: 65
Poder: 16
coej Va por buen camino
Si lo raro es que yo estoy escogiendo create generator, no se porque me pone sequence????

y acabo de crear registrar una nueva bd, con otro nombre, con dialecto 3, y al crear el generador y luego la secuencia, me sigue dando el mismo error..

Para poner otro error por si ayuda a identificar este, lo siguiente es crear procedures, y al crearla, me da error en la palabra or del create or alter procedure...
¿¿¿¿
Responder Con Cita
  #2  
Antiguo 16-05-2011
Avatar de guillotmarc
guillotmarc guillotmarc is offline
Miembro
 
Registrado: may 2003
Ubicación: Huelva
Posts: 2.638
Poder: 26
guillotmarc Va por buen camino
Pon esta sentencia en el SQL Editor, y ejecútala : CREATE GENERATOR GEN_BANCOS_ID;

¿ Se crea correctamente el generador ?.

Las sentencias CREATE PROCEDURE las tienes que poner en el Script Executive (ya que hay más de una sentencia involucrada).

Saludos.
__________________
Marc Guillot (Hi ha 10 tipus de persones, els que saben binari i els que no).
Responder Con Cita
  #3  
Antiguo 16-05-2011
coej coej is offline
Miembro
NULL
 
Registrado: abr 2011
Ubicación: MANCHEGO-ESPAÑOL
Posts: 65
Poder: 16
coej Va por buen camino
Si, se genera correctamente la sentencia con el sql editor...
Y a continuación puedo genera el trigger desde la edición del campo...
Lo que no entiendo es porque no puedo hacerlo de la otra forma, y porque no me reconoce el comando sequence...
Después he intentado eliminar el trigger, y el generator, el trigger lo he podido eliminar, pero el generator, no me deja
ni con
Código SQL [-]
drop generator GEN_BANCOS_ID;
ni con
Código SQL [-]
drop sequence GEN_BANCOS_ID;
En el editor de sql, no me reconoce ni generator, ni sequence, me da error en ese comando...

Con respecto a las procedures, no se pueden crear con botón derecho sobre el arbol de la izquierda y generarlo???, en la guia que he seguido los genera asi...

Gracias por la respuesta guillotmarc, al menos así puedo generar el trigger, luego probare con el procedure donde me comentas, pero es un fastidio que no funcione por el que creo que debería ser su funcionamiento normal...
Responder Con Cita
  #4  
Antiguo 16-05-2011
Avatar de Casimiro Noteví
Casimiro Noteví Casimiro Noteví is offline
Merodeador
 
Registrado: sep 2004
Ubicación: En algún lugar.
Posts: 32.670
Poder: 10
Casimiro Noteví Tiene un aura espectacularCasimiro Noteví Tiene un aura espectacular
También puede ser que esa versión de ibexpert tenga algún bug en ese apartado, suele ocurrir a veces, es uno de los motivos por los que sacan versiones nuevas muy seguidas.
Responder Con Cita
  #5  
Antiguo 16-05-2011
coej coej is offline
Miembro
NULL
 
Registrado: abr 2011
Ubicación: MANCHEGO-ESPAÑOL
Posts: 65
Poder: 16
coej Va por buen camino
gracias casimiro, haber si alguien me puede decir alguna version o pasar un enlace de ibexpert(la versión gratuita), y que funcione, porque es un chasco grande que no funcione esto, con lo sencillo que sería o crear las procedure

P.d--> Tengo w7 x64 bits, espero que esto no sea otro foco de problemas...
Responder Con Cita
  #6  
Antiguo 17-05-2011
Avatar de Casimiro Noteví
Casimiro Noteví Casimiro Noteví is offline
Merodeador
 
Registrado: sep 2004
Ubicación: En algún lugar.
Posts: 32.670
Poder: 10
Casimiro Noteví Tiene un aura espectacularCasimiro Noteví Tiene un aura espectacular
Yo tengo una versión de hace varios años
Responder Con Cita
  #7  
Antiguo 17-05-2011
coej coej is offline
Miembro
NULL
 
Registrado: abr 2011
Ubicación: MANCHEGO-ESPAÑOL
Posts: 65
Poder: 16
coej Va por buen camino
He estado por privados con ecfisa, y me ha aconsejado instalar otro manejador para probar, el ibmanager, y con este si que me crea el generador y el trigger???, con los procedures no he probado aún, el cree que puede ser porque tengo w764bits, aunque yo creo que puede ser más o la versión de ibexpert(porque tengo la versión reducida), o porque he configurado mal en la instalacion...
Haber si alguien me pudiera pasar el enlace de una versión más antigua para probar, ya que creo que ibexpert no guarda historila de versiones,no creo que la instalación de firebird tenga que ver nada con esto no???
Como última prueba, desistale ibexpert, e instale la versión más reciente que la que tenía del 3 de abril, y me hace lo mismo...
Estoy un poco desorientado, la verdad, no se por donde cogerlo...
Responder Con Cita
Respuesta


Herramientas Buscar en Tema
Buscar en Tema:

Búsqueda Avanzada
Desplegado

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ro

Temas Similares
Tema Autor Foro Respuestas Último mensaje
No Encuentro el Error del Trigger en FireBird 2.5 teletranx Firebird e Interbase 7 06-06-2011 22:03:25
Error al generar Trigger saltamirano Conexión con bases de datos 1 12-12-2007 19:35:53
Error en columna en Trigger brakaman Firebird e Interbase 2 13-06-2007 18:14:14
Error Calculos Trigger ASAPLTDA Firebird e Interbase 3 23-06-2006 14:30:13
Trigger ... error al crear Tomás Firebird e Interbase 6 06-05-2003 21:00:56


La franja horaria es GMT +2. Ahora son las 01:32:49.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2026,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i